Greek Salad Omelette
Who says eggs have to be boring? this is a hearty vegetarian meal that could be as at home for an evening meal as it is for breakfast. i originally found this recipe in bbc good food magazine.
Steps
Heat the grill / broiler to high.
Whisk the eggs in a large bowl with the chopped parsley , pepper and salt , if you want.
Heat the oil in a large non-stick frying pan , then fry the onion wedges over a high heat for about 4 mins until they start to brown around the edges.
Throw in the tomatoes and olives and cook for 1-2 mins until the tomatoes begin to soften.
Turn the heat down to medium and pour in the eggs.
Cook the eggs in the pan , stirring them as they begin to set , until half cooked , but still runny in places - about 2 minutes.
Scatter over the feta , then place the pan under the grill for 5-6 mins until omelette is puffed up and golden.
Cut into wedges and serve straight from the pan.
Ingredients
eggs, fresh parsley, olive oil, red onion, tomatoes, black olives, feta cheese
